Where is the Brylle family from?

You can see how Brylle families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Brylle family name was found in the USA, and Scotland between 1871 and 1920. The most Brylle families were found in Scotland in 1871. In 1871 there were 7 Brylle families living in Renfrewshire. This was 100% of all the recorded Brylle's in Scotland. Renfrewshire had the highest population of Brylle families in 1871.

What is the average Brylle lifespan?

Between 1967 and 1995, in the United States, Brylle life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1967, and highest in 1995. The average life expectancy for Brylle in 1967 was 50, and 74 in 1995.
